pop and Confusion said on Wednesday (May 6) that they had amicably ended the partnership that would have integrated Perplexity’s AI-powered answer engine into Snap’s Snapchat Social media platform, The Wall Street Journal (WSJ) I mentioned Wednesday.
Perplexity told the Wall Street Journal that the two companies decided the collaboration did not fit their product goals, according to the report.
“Perplexity continues to value Snapchat as a platform for reaching key audiences, remains active on the Snap platform, and expects to continue to use Snap advertising products,” Perplexity said, according to the report.
Snape said in the first quarter Investor letter Released on Wednesday: “Our revenue guidance range assumes no contribution from Perplexity as we amicably terminated the relationship in the first quarter.”
The company said in the previous fourth quarter Investor letter Released on February 4: “The scope of our Q1 revenue guidance excludes any potential revenue from the Perplexity integration as we have not yet agreed on a path to broader rollout.”
Snap announced partnership In November, Perplexity said it would pay it $400 million over one year to integrate Snapchat’s AI-powered answer engine.

The company said this represents the first integration of a third-party AI partner directly into Snapchat as well as the first step in Snap’s efforts to make the app a platform through which AI companies can connect with its 943 million monthly active users.
At the time, Snap said Perplexity would begin appearing in Snapchat in early 2026.

Meanwhile, Snap announced on Wednesday Earnings release The company’s revenues in the first quarter increased by 12% year-on-year to reach $1.5 billion.
The number of global monthly active users for Snapchat increased 5% year over year to 956 million, while the number of global daily active users rose 5% to 483 million, the company said.
During the quarter, Snapchat launched a format called AI Sponsored Snaps that allows brands to engage Snapchat users through interactive, AI-powered conversations.
